Core Functions and Industrial Use Cases

A heavy-duty PTZ mechanism is designed for two primary axes of motion: pan (horizontal rotation) and tilt (vertical rotation). Unlike consumer-grade units, industrial versions are built with high-torque motors, reinforced housings, and often feature environmental sealing.

Precision Positioning and Load Management

The key to performance lies in precise positioning. These units offer smooth, accurate movement even under maximum load, which is critical for applications like robotic welding arms or long-range surveillance cameras where minute adjustments matter.

Ruggedized Construction for Harsh Environments

Industrial settings expose equipment to dust, moisture, vibration, and extreme temperatures. A true heavy duty pan tilt unit is built with materials like hardened aluminum alloys and features IP ratings to withstand these challenges, ensuring continuous operation.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the typical load capacity for a heavy-duty pan tilt?

Capacities vary widely, but industrial units often support loads from 25kg (55 lbs) to over 80kg (176 lbs) or more, catering to heavy cameras, LiDAR systems, or lighting apparatus.

How are these units controlled?

Control is typically achieved via serial communication protocols (like RS-485/Pelco-D/P), IP-based network commands, or analog control boxes, allowing for seamless integration into larger automation or security systems.

What maintenance do they require?

Designed for durability, they require minimal maintenance. Periodic checks for seal integrity and gear lubrication are recommended, especially in high-cycle or extreme environments.
